Description: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va, is located beach front on Isla Cristina in the province of Huelva, and is easily accessible from the beach by a pleasant stroll through a protected natural area (approx. 600 m.) Isla Cristina has exceptional natural conditions for snorkeling, windsurfing and other water sports in a sunny and warm environment all year long.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va has a buffet restaurant with an outdoor terrace,also a hall bar and lobby bar, both with a terrace, a pool bar.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va has a outdoor pool for adults and children also gardens - a fitness centre - sauna - beauty salon - massage service - putting green for practising golf and private indoor parking facilities.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va has 212 double rooms, 4 of them especially equipped for the disabled, 14 doubles with lounge 3 junior suites, 4 master suites.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va rooms all have air conditioning, ceiling fan, terrace, en suite bathroom with hair dryer, international TV, minibar, telephone and safe deposit box. The junior and master suites also have bed-settees, magnifying mirrors and trouser press.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va also have 96 one-bedroom apartments, 9 two-bedroom apartments and 5 studios, 4 of them equipped for the disabled. All the apartments have air conditioning, ceiling fan, terrace, bathroom with hair dryer, fully equipped kitchen, refrigerator, bed-settee in the lounge, international TV, telephone and safe deposit box. Meeting Rooms Locally: Barcelo Isla Cristina Huelva is located in the urban heart of the fishing village of Isla Cristina, with a population of 20,000 residents and offers all the services of a small city PLACES TO SEE The Queen Victoria Workers' Quarter. A group of terraced family homes in the English architectural style, built in 1917. Each terrace is distinguished by unique construction details that distinguish it from the rest. La Merced Cathedral. Founded in 1605 and consecrated as a Cathedral in 1953, it contains a beautiful carving of the Christ of Jerusalem and an exquisite likeness of the Virgin of the Cinta. Church of La Concepción. Built in the 16th century, the interior houses paintings by Zurbarán. It also boasts an extremely valuable choir stall. San Marcos Castle. Built in the 16th century, this castle is a magnificent example of Renaissance architecture. Monastery of La RábidaStanding atop a hill where the Phoenicians erected an altar to their God Baal and the Romans in turn built a temple to the Goddess Prosperina, this monastery was taken over by the Franciscans at the beginning of the 15th century. |
